Private Cooking Lesson and Meal with A Kyoto Local

Kyoto Trip Overview

Join your host Midori in her home and watch as she cooks a traditional Japanese meal. You can choose from one of three set menus that she offers – Teriyaki Chicken (teriyaki chicken, 2 seasonal vegetables, miso soup, rice), Maki Sushi (maki sushi, tamago yaki, 1 seasonal vegetable, miso soup) or Kansai Street Snacks (okonomiyaki, takoyaki, yaki gyoza, miso soup). Midori likes to create dishes from simple and easy recipes that you can easily recreate back home. This will be a cooking demonstration where you will watch Midori cook using seasonal and traditional ingredients. The cooking portion of the experience will last one hour, after which you will sit down and share a meal together.

After the meal, if you’re interested, Midori can even take you to the local supermarket to buy a few local Japanese ingredients to take back home.

Midori will welcome you with smoked tea, a classic Japanese tea and wagashi, traditional confections typically eaten with tea. She will then introduce you to traditional Japanese ingredients used to prepare a homemade Japanese meal – soy sauce, mirin, sake, and miso. Feel free to ask her about any ingredient and learn about the recipes that bring those ingredients to life!

Midori offers Halal, Kosher and Vegan Meals as well, so please inform her your preference while creating the booking. She also offers three set menus, so don’t forget to mention your preference when making your online booking. This experience is also great for families with children!
